The program is for a new cultural center. The site is located on Dewey Square Park on the Greenway in Boston. The park is right above I-93 highway that runs underground throughout the downtown area. Site analysis diagrams are based off perceptual observations of three layered urban characteristics, green space/planting, car traffic, and pedestrian traffic. The design process was oriented around the connection between layers both physically and exponentially. The car ramps that connect the two layers of above ground, and below ground provided a physical element from the site that was then abstracted both physically, and exponentially to come up with a site specific tectonic that the architecture embodies. To create a conceptual problem in which the design of the building became a solution for the connection between these layers.
